Learn more about Digital Communication Course programs
Digital Communication degree programs provide you with the chance to explore a rapidly evolving field that combines technology, creativity, and strategic thinking. These programs cover a range of topics including media production, content creation, and digital marketing, allowing you to develop skills applicable across various industries.
Through courses in digital media strategies, you’ll learn to craft effective messaging for diverse audiences. You’ll delve into analytics to measure engagement and adapt content accordingly. The environment encourages students to strengthen adaptability as they explore new ideas and technologies, making it easier to stay current in the field.
By the end of your studies, you’ll have hands-on experience with digital tools, including social media platforms and content management systems, essential for today’s communication landscape. Graduates typically pursue roles such as digital marketing specialists, content strategists, and communication managers. With a solid foundation in digital communication, you’ll be well-prepared for an array of career opportunities across multiple sectors.
